What Is an Operations Director – Learning Solutions?
An Operations Director – Learning Solutions is a strategic leader who oversees all operational aspects of digital learning platforms, educational technologies, and instructional services within educational settings. This individual ensures the effective design, implementation, and management of learning solutions that enhance the teaching and learning experiences for students, faculty, and staff. As educational institutions increasingly adopt technology-driven systems, the demand for talented operations directors continues to rise.
Key Responsibilities of an Operations Director – Learning Solutions
This pivotal role requires a multifaceted skill set and the ability to manage complex education technology projects.Below are the core responsibilities you can expect:
- Strategic Planning: Develop and execute strategies for integrating learning technology solutions that align wiht institutional goals and enhance student outcomes.
- Project Leadership: Lead cross-functional teams to plan, implement, and evaluate the success of learning initiatives, such as Learning Management Systems (LMS), blended learning environments, and digital content distribution.
- Vendor & stakeholder management: Select,negotiate with,and manage relationships with external vendors,technology providers,faculty,and administrative staff to ensure seamless service delivery.
- Operational Oversight: Oversee day-to-day operations related to learning technologies, including technical support, troubleshooting, and system upgrades.
- Quality Assurance: Monitor and assess the effectiveness of educational technology solutions, ensuring they meet institutional standards and user needs.
- Budget Management: Manage budgets, allocate resources efficiently, and ensure cost-effectiveness in the acquisition and implementation of learning solutions.
- data-Driven Decision Making: Use data analytics and user feedback to inform improvements and demonstrate the impact of learning technology interventions.
- Compliance & Security: Ensure all technology practices comply with data privacy regulations and institutional security policies.
Essential Skills for a Successful Operations Director – Learning Solutions
To excel in this role,you’ll need a balance of technical expertise,strategic thinking,and outstanding interpersonal skills. Here are some of the most sought-after competencies:
- Educational Technology Familiarity: Deep understanding of learning management systems, e-learning tools, content authoring platforms, and instructional design methodologies.
- Leadership & Team Management: Ability to inspire, mentor, and coordinate diverse teams including IT professionals, instructional designers, and educators.
- Change management: Expertise in managing organizational change, especially during technology rollouts and transitions.
- Analytical & problem-Solving Skills: Proficiency in analyzing data, evaluating outcomes, and finding creative solutions to complex challenges.
- Project Management: Strong skills in planning, executing, and monitoring projects within set timelines and budgets.
- Interaction & Collaboration: Clear communicator who can engage with stakeholders at all levels, translate technical language, and foster a collaborative culture.
- Financial Acumen: Experience in overseeing budgets, contracts, and resource allocation.
- Continuous Learning: Commitment to staying informed about emerging technologies and best practices in educational innovation.

Qualifications & Career Pathways
If you’re interested in becoming an Operations Director – Learning Solutions, consider the following educational and career milestones:
- Education: A bachelor’s degree in education, instructional technology, details systems, or buisness is essential.A master’s or doctorate greatly enhances career prospects.
- Experience: Employers usually require several years of experience in project management, educational technology, or related leadership roles.
- Certifications: Programs in project management (e.g., PMP) or educational technology (e.g., ISTE Certification for Educators) are advantageous.
- Professional Development: Participate in workshops, webinars, conferences, and online courses to stay updated on the latest trends and tools.

Future Trends in Education Technology Operations
The landscape for learning solutions is rapidly evolving, and operations directors must adapt to stay ahead. Some trends shaping the future of this field include:
- Adaptive learning and AI: Leveraging artificial intelligence to personalize student experiences and automate routine processes.
- Hybrid and Remote Learning: Expanding flexible learning options that blend in-person and online instruction.
- Data Security and Privacy: prioritizing robust data protection in compliance with legal and ethical standards.
- Mobile Learning: Designing solutions optimized for smartphones and tablets,meeting learners wherever they are.
- Accessibility and Inclusion: ensuring digital learning tools and content are accessible to all, regardless of ability.
